There is nothing more telling of Thanksgiving Day than the smell of cooked turkey wafting through the house. Unless, of course, Thanksgiving smells to you like deep-fried Turkey wafting through the backyard.

For almost 25% of Americans consuming turkey on Thanksgiving, the preferred method of cooking the bird is in a huge vat of oil. Not only does deep-frying a turkey seal in the flavor and make it extra-delicious, it also cuts the cooking time in half.

[Serious Eats]
[Serious Eats]

But if you are going to dunk your bird in a bath of boiling oil, please do yourself a favor and cook it outside… and never under any circumstances, ever put a frozen turkey straight into the oil!

Police officers and firefighters demonstrated why you should always thaw a frozen turkey before you deep-fry it and the results are alarming. Take a look at the following video and remember these statistics: each year, fryer fires are responsible for approximately 5 deaths, 60 injuries, and the destruction of nearly 900 homes on Thanksgiving Day.
